The 350 Egyptian pilgrims who traveled to Saudi Arabia to perform Umrah and were held at Jeddah airport are safely on board a Saudi Arabian flight and en route to Cairo International Airport, said Amr Roushdy, spokesman for the Egyptian Ministry of Foreign Affairs. Roushdy said these 350 Egyptians are the last of the pilgrims held at Jedda airport. Saudi Arabian Airlines earlier cancelled flights to Cairo and Egyptian pilgrims returning home were stuck in the King Abdel Aziz Airport for four days.
